Chromosomes are threadlike structures made up of DNA and protein, while a gene is a segment of DNA on a chromosome that controls a particular trait. An allele is an alternate form of a trait. Homozygous means that all of the alleles are the same in the DNA, and heterozygous means that the alleles are mixed up. For example, homozygous would be PP or pp, and heterozygous would be Pp. * There has been a major effort in the history of science to figure out the structure of DNA. Having a double standard helix DNA has a uniform a diameter in its entire length. The helixes fit within a defined three dimensional space because they are both right handed. Polynucleotide chains are held together by the bases in the (center) hydrogen bonding with the bases on the opposite polynucleotide. Two polynucleotides are form around the outside of the helix with the bases extending into the center. Known as complementary base pairing; hydrogen bonding is a very specific process. Scientist had identified all the atoms and knew how they were bound together. What was not understood was the capacity to store genetic information, copy it and pass it from generation to generation, and the specific three dimensional arrangements of atoms that gave DNA its unique proprieties.…

Genes are found in our chromosomes,which parents pass on to offspring in their sex cells in reproduction. Different versions of the same gene are called alleles, and these can determine features like eye colour, and the inheritance of disorders such as cystic fibrosis.…
